[. . . ] BEFORE INSTALLATION Never leave packaging residues unattended in the home. Separate waste packaging materials by type and consign them to the nearest separate disposal centre. The inside of the appliance should be cleaned to remove all manufacturing residues. When the oven and grill are used for the first time, they should be heated to the maximum temperature for long enough to burn off any oily residues left by the manufacturing process, which might contaminate foods with unpleasant smells. 34 Instructions for the User 6. DESCRIPTION OF FRONT PANEL CONTROLS All the cooker's control and monitoring devices are placed together on the front panel. The table below provides the key to the symbols used. 35 Instructions for the User FUNCTION SELECTOR KNOB (STATIC OVEN) The cooking temperature is selected by turning the knob clockwise to the value required, between 50° and 240/250°C (depending on the model). For different heating effects, users can switch on only the bottom heating element ( ) or only the grill element ( ). At the end of the knob rotation scale, the symbol switches on the rotisserie motor and the grill top heating element. THERMOSTAT KNOB (MULTIFUNCTION OVEN) The cooking temperature is selected by turning the knob clockwise to the value required, between 50° and 240/250°C (depending on the model). THERMOSTAT LIGHT Illuminates to indicate that the oven is heating up. Goes out when the set temperature is reached; flashes at regular intervals to indicate that the temperature inside the oven is being kept constantly at the set level. 36 Instructions for the User FUNCTION CONTROL KNOB (MULTIFUNCTION OVEN) Rotate the knob in either direction to select desired function from the following: NO FUNCTION SET THAWING INSIDE LIGHT (NO HEATING ELEMENTS ON) TOP+BOTTOM HEATING ELEMENTS GRILL ELEMENT IN OPERATION ALTERNATING WITH BOTTOM HEATING ELEMENT + FAN GRILL ELEMENT TOP+BOTTOM HEATING ELEMENTS+FAN GRILL ELEMENT + FAN FAN HEATING ELEMENT SMALL GRILL ELEMENT + FAN BOTTOM HEATING ELEMENT BOTTOM HEATING ELEMENT + FAN TOP+BOTTOM HEATING ELEMENTS + FAN HEATING ELEMENT SMALL GRILL ELEMENT MINUTE MINDER KNOB Setting is on a gradual scale and intermediate positions between the numbers can be used. TIMER KNOB Allows selection of manual cooking or the minute minder function with the oven automatically switched off at the end of the cooking time. Tray grid: for placing on top of a tray for cooking foods which may drip. Oven tray: useful for collecting fat from foods placed on the grid above. Roof liner: remove it to simplify cleaning inside the oven. Rotisserie shelf (models with static oven only): for fitting onto the oven runners before the rotisserie rod is used. Rotisserie rod (models with static oven only): useful for cooking chicken, sausages and all foods which require uniform cooking over their entire surface. Chromium-plated gripper: useful for removing hot shelves and trays. Not all accessories are provided on some models. Optional accessories Original accessories can be ordered through our Authorised Service Centres. 41 Instructions for the User 9. COOKING ADVICE The oven should always be preheated in fan mode to 30/40°C above the cooking temperature. This considerably shortens cooking times and reduces electricity consumption, as well as giving better results. The oven door must be closed during cooking operations. 9. 1 Conventional cooking FUNCTION SELECTOR THERMOSTAT 50 ÷ 250 °C This conventional cooking method, with heat from above and below, is suitable for cooking food on just one shelf. Do not place the food in the oven until the thermostat light goes out. The only precaution required is to set temperatures about 20°C lower and cooking times about 1/4 longer than for fresh meat. 9. 2 Hot air cooking FUNCTION SELECTOR THERMOSTAT 50 ÷ 250 °C This system is suitable for cooking on several shelves, even with foods of different kinds (fish, meat, etc. ) without cross-contamination of flavours or smells.
